25. 

Negative feedback reduces noise originating at the amplifier input.

A. True
B. False

Answer: Option B

Explanation:

It has no effect on noise originating at amplifier input.

26. 

Assertion (A): For large signal variations an amplifier circuit has to be analysed graphically

Reason (R): The output characteristics of a transistor is nonlinear.

A. Both A and R are correct and R is correct explanation for A
B. Both A and R are correct but R is not correct explanation for A
C. A is correct R is wrong
D. A is wrong R is correct

Answer: Option A

Explanation:

Since the characteristics is non-linear, graphical analysis is needed.

27. 

Assertion (A): CE amplifier is the most widely used BJT amplifier

Reason (R): CE amplifier has zero phase difference between input and output

A. Both A and R are correct and R is correct explanation for A
B. Both A and R are correct but R is not correct explanation for A
C. A is correct R is wrong
D. A is wrong R is correct

Answer: Option C

Explanation:

There is 180° phase difference between input and output.

28. 

The efficiency of a full wave rectifier using centre tapped transformer is twice that in full wave bridge rectifier.

A. True
B. False

Answer: Option B

Explanation:

Efficiency of full wave rectifier with centre tapped transformer is slightly higher than that of bridge rectifier.

31. 

An amplifier has a large ac input signal. The clipping occurs on both the peaks. The output voltage will be nearly a

A. sine wave
B. square wave
C. triangular wave
D. (a) or (c)

Answer: Option B

Explanation:

When a sinusoidal voltage is clipped on both sides it resembles a square wave.
